Sunday 4th February 2024

Walk 1

Lord's Seat to Greystones

Leader: Pete Rutland

Report & Photos by

Pete Rutland

 

 

 

 

 

 

.

 
Another cracking day with 12 souls getting out there and testing their gear out.  Heading up through Whinlatter Forest it was obvious that on the open fell side it was going to be a bit breezy. As we came out of the shelter of the trees approaching the short climb to the top of Lords Seat it was also obvious we had slightly underestimated the wind. So much so that a few stayed in the shelter of the trees (this decision having some merit) whilst a few linked arms and struggled onto Lords Seat in a very haphazard way, looking like a bunch of drunks as we went backwards, forwards, sideways and eventually up hill and down again. Venturing any further on the open ground to Broom Fell was a none starter so it was back to the visitor centre for a 12pm lunch.
After Lunch we went back into Braithwaite, parked up and not to be totally defeated set off on a low level assault of the countryside. We went to Swinside, Stair and back under Barrow and into the Cafe at Braithwaite. A walk that turned out pretty well, didn’t get wet and only the odd gust of wind to contend with. At least it gave us the 8 miles we should have done. Thanks to the bunch who came out and saw the sense of having to change the walk which is always a bit of a disappointment, better luck next time.
